Cast your vote for the winner of the inaugural Lord Mayor’s Green Heart Photography Competition and go into the running for a holiday on Tangalooma Island.

Aspiring photographers were asked to submit creative, emotive and inspiring images of beautiful Brisbane to encourage viewers to protect and enhance the city’s natural environment through making sustainable choices.

The idea behind the competition was inspiring residents to work towards keeping Brisbane clean, green and sustainable together.

Clean can mean contributing to a low carbon city, working towards cleaner air, and reducing, reusing and recycling resources as much as possible.

Green can mean growing our urban forests, creating more shade in neighbourhoods, enjoying shared outdoor green spaces, protecting bushland and parks, and growing biodiversity to ensure Brisbane’s 35% natural habitat cover stays on track for 40%.

Sustainable can mean choosing green transport options more often, being smart with how we use and enjoy water, designing Buildings that Breathe and neighbourhoods that embrace development that enhances our sub-tropical lifestyle.
